    I first bought a HDMI cable to expand my computer screen on a TV, but after a while I ran into a problem. The sound stopped working. I later bought a HD PVR Decder for my TV, and it solved the problem when I plugged it in (new cable, also HDMI). It suddenly started working with my old cable and PC -> TV. I sold the PVR decoder when I moved, and PC -> TV still worked. Then after a few days it stopped working and I only had video again, no sound. I thought it might be a video card/computer problem, but I just bought a Blu-ray player, and sound doesn't work on it either. I bought a new HDMI cable, still no sound. So I figure it has to be the TV.

    Is there any way to fix it? Does anyone know what causes it? Btw, my TV is a Daewoo DLP-32C3.
